WebC3 and C4 plants (1) stomata stay open all day and close at night. CAM plants (2) stomata open during the morning and close slightly at noon and then open again in the evening. WebPlants have problems if they lose too much water, so stomata close during hot, dry periods when transpiration is highest. However, CO 2, which is needed for photosynthesis, also enters the plant through open stomata. Thus, if stomata stay closed a long time to stop water loss, not enough CO 2 will enter for photosynthesis. As a result ...

WebFeb 4, 2010 · Stomata usually open when leaves are transferred from darkness to light. However, reverse-phase stomatal opening in succulent plants has been known. CAM plants such as cacti and Opuntia ficus–indica achieve their high water use efficiency by opening their stomata during the cool, desert nights and closing them during the hot, dry days. …

Certain stimuli trigger the … shut down llc californiaWebApr 12, 2024 · It has been known for some time that the gene STOMAGEN (short for “stomata generator”) is crucial for the development of stomata. Previously, researchers have reduced the number of stomata by disabling or “knocking out” the STOMAGEN gene in rice.
